The Basilica of Our Lady of Guadalupe in Mexico City is one of the most important Catholic pilgrimage sites in the world. Known for its deep spiritual significance and beautiful architecture, it welcomes millions of visitors each year to honor Our Lady of Guadalupe and experience the rich faith and culture of Mexico.
The National Museum of Anthropology in Mexico City is one of the most renowned museums in Latin America, featuring incredible exhibits on Mexico’s rich history and indigenous cultures. From the Aztec Sun Stone to ancient Mayan artifacts, it offers a fascinating look into the country’s cultural heritage and traditions.
Templo Mayor is an important archaeological site in the heart of Mexico City, showcasing the ruins of the main temple of the ancient Aztec capital, Tenochtitlán. Visitors can explore fascinating ruins and artifacts that offer a glimpse into Mexico’s rich pre-Hispanic history and culture.
Santa Fe is a modern district in Mexico City known for its impressive skyline, luxury shopping centers, business hubs, and contemporary restaurants. With a mix of modern architecture and lively entertainment, it offers a different perspective of the city’s vibrant urban culture.
